Giovin Re by Michele Satta is a Tuscan white wine made from 100% Viognier grapes. Vinified and aged in re-dried barriques and half in cement, it has an extraordinary typically Mediterranean aroma and strength.

Contrada Barbatto Muro Sant'Angelo is a niche edition of the Primitivo DOC Gioia del Colle by Tenute Chiaromonte. It comes from grapes grown in a small vineyard of ancient trees. The color is deep red. The aromas are those of plum jam and bitter chocolate that barely covers the smoky notes. Do not miss the typical scents of the Mediterranean maquis. On the palate it is cherry-like, deep and intense, with very soft tannins.

Muro Sant'Angelo by Tenute Chiaromonte is a 100% Primitivo which has obtained the Gioia del Colle DOC recognition for its unique characteristics. Intense red wine, with spicy and fruity aromas of plum and small black fruits. Impact on the palate, volume without sagging, excellent acidity that well balances the typical sweetness of the vine. Pleasant finish, poured by notes of chocolate and licorice.

Discover the Tuscan Bordeaux wine Le Cupole by Franchetti Wines, the second wine of Trinoro Estate. A blend of four Merlot, Cabernet Franc, Cabernet Sauvignon and Petit Verdot grape varieties, Le Cupole is an exuberant red wine, rich in ripe fruit and extracted tannins. Due to the cold the grapes ripened late and for this reason the wine obtained has a less dense body than other vintages but is fresher.

From the Tuscan vine par excellence, Sangiovese, in a blend with Cabernet Sauvignon and Syrah grapes, comes Summus, the Supertuscan of Castello Banfi. Produced in the Montalcino area and only in excellent vintages, Summus is a long-aging Tuscan red wine of great character, rare structure and extraordinary elegance.
